    Ive taught motion and storyboard design at art center in pasadena on and off the past 4 or so years and it seems no different than other classes Ive sat in classes at.

    Dont ever let them finish the work they are late on over the course of the semester. If they are late with a project they fail not questions.

    3 absences and they fail. They should show up for how much schools cost these days its not that hard.

    Dont give them 'real world' projects but crit and grade them like the real world would. Emulating existing client work just gets you a bunch of copies back which does no one any good.

    Keep your projects purposefully open ended and abstract to make them think but in a way where they walk away with a piece they can use in their portfolio. No one gives a shit about resumes, the works the currency of success even at a student level.

    War stories go the distance. they love hearing about it to understand their options.

    Encourage them. Its amazing how many teachers tell kids what they cant do with no real encouragement to think big.
